Shakepay joins Interac e-Transfer as participant

Shakepay has become a participant in the Interac e-Transfer service, strengthening its connection to one of the country’s most widely used payment networks and expanding its payments infrastructure.

The company said the move has established a more direct connection with the Interac network, giving it greater control over how customers transfer money into and out of the Shakepay platform. The participation is expected to improve operational efficiency while providing a stronger foundation for future product development.

Interac e-Transfer is one of Canada’s most commonly used digital payment services, enabling consumers to send and receive funds between financial institutions. By becoming a participant, Shakepay has joined the network directly rather than relying solely on intermediary banking relationships.

Shakepay said the development has aligned with its strategy of making access to Bitcoin and digital financial services more familiar for Canadian users by integrating with trusted domestic payment infrastructure.

Since its launch, Shakepay has focused on enabling Canadians to buy and hold Bitcoin, transfer money and manage savings through a single platform. According to the company, more than 1.5 million Canadians now use its services.

The announcement came as digital asset platforms continue to strengthen links with established financial infrastructure to improve user experience and increase adoption. Interac said its e-Transfer service processed more than 1.6 billion transactions during the previous year, highlighting its role as a key component of Canada’s payments ecosystem.

Shakepay said becoming an Interac e-Transfer participant has represented another step in building a broader Canadian financial platform, supporting the development of new products designed to help customers move money more efficiently, access Bitcoin and participate in the evolving digital economy.
